Mudjhiri
Mudjhiri is a village located in Gyaraspur tehsil of Vidisha district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Gyaraspur (tehsildar office) and 45km away from district headquarter Vidisha. As per 2009 stats, Ghatera is the gram panchayat of Mudjhiri village.

About Mudjhiri
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mudjhiri is 481611. The village spans a total geographical area of 591.97 hectares. Gyaraspur is nearest town to Mudjhiri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Mudjhiri
Below is a concise population overview of Mudjhiri as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 382 | 206 | 176 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 82 | 45 | 37 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 380 | 205 | 175 |
Literate Population | 162 | 96 | 66 |
Illiterate Population | 220 | 110 | 110 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mudjhiri village:
- The total population of Mudjhiri village is around 382, including approximately 206 males and 176 females, with a sex ratio of 854 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 82 children aged 0–6 years in Mudjhiri village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Mudjhiri village has 380 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Mudjhiri village is about 42.41%, with male literacy at 46.60% and female literacy at 37.50%.
- There are around 73 households in Mudjhiri village.
Connectivity of Mudjhiri
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mudjhiri. As per the 2011 stats, Mudjhiri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
